Jacques is from your Latin identify Jacobus. It's a masculine identify that means "supplanter" or "a person who follows". It is usually associated with the Hebrew title Yaakov, which means "he who supplants".[2]

a male provided identify, the French equal of James and Jacob, and formerly made use of being a generic identify for peasants
